The Rise of Sustainable Materials
One of the most significant trends in custom cabinetry for 2023 is the shift towards sustainable materials. Homeowners are becoming more environmentally conscious, seeking options that minimize their carbon footprint while still providing durability and style.
Popular Sustainable Choices
Bamboo: Known for its rapid growth and renewability, bamboo is a popular choice for eco-friendly cabinetry. It offers a unique aesthetic with its natural grain and can be finished in various colors.
Reclaimed Wood: Using reclaimed wood not only reduces waste but also adds character and history to your cabinetry. Each piece tells a story, making your kitchen or bathroom truly one-of-a-kind.
Low-VOC Finishes: Homeowners are opting for finishes that emit fewer volatile organic compounds (VOCs), ensuring better indoor air quality. These finishes come in a variety of colors and textures, allowing for customization without compromising health.
Minimalist Designs with Maximum Impact
Minimalism continues to be a dominant trend in home design, and cabinetry is no exception. In 2023, the focus is on clean lines, simple shapes, and a clutter-free aesthetic.
Key Features of Minimalist Cabinetry
Flat-Panel Doors: These doors create a sleek look, often with no visible hardware. They are perfect for achieving a modern, streamlined appearance.
Integrated Handles: Instead of traditional knobs or pulls, many homeowners are choosing integrated handles that blend seamlessly into the cabinetry. This design choice enhances the minimalist vibe.
Neutral Color Palettes: Soft whites, grays, and earth tones dominate the color schemes, allowing for a calm and serene environment. These colors also make spaces feel larger and more open.

Bold Colors and Textures
While minimalism is on the rise, 2023 also sees a resurgence of bold colors and textures in cabinetry. Homeowners are embracing vibrant hues and unique finishes to make a statement in their spaces.
Trending Colors
Deep Blues and Greens: These rich colors add depth and sophistication to kitchens and bathrooms. Pairing them with brass or gold hardware creates a luxurious look.
Warm Earth Tones: Shades like terracotta and ochre bring warmth and coziness to spaces. They work well in rustic or farmhouse-style homes.
Two-Tone Cabinetry: Mixing and matching colors is a popular trend, allowing homeowners to create visual interest. For example, pairing navy lower cabinets with white upper cabinets can create a striking contrast.
Unique Textures
Textured Finishes: Cabinetry with textured surfaces, such as ribbed or fluted designs, adds dimension and tactile appeal. These finishes can be used on doors or as accents.
Matte vs. Glossy: The choice between matte and glossy finishes can dramatically affect the overall look. Matte finishes offer a sophisticated, understated elegance, while glossy finishes reflect light and create a more dynamic appearance.
Smart Storage Solutions
As homes become more multifunctional, the need for smart storage solutions in cabinetry is more important than ever. In 2023, custom cabinetry is being designed with innovative features that maximize space and enhance usability.
Innovative Storage Ideas
Pull-Out Shelves: These shelves make it easy to access items in the back of deep cabinets, reducing the frustration of digging through clutter.
Corner Cabinets: Utilizing corner spaces effectively is crucial. Lazy Susans or pull-out racks can transform these often-overlooked areas into valuable storage.
Built-In Organizers: Custom cabinetry can include built-in organizers for utensils, spices, and even appliances, keeping everything tidy and within reach.
